If you're looking for a role where your work truly makes a difference and every day brings something new - this could be the role for you! You'll be an essential part of delivering an exceptional client experience. Your behind-the-scenes magic will ensure accurate, timely support to Financial Planners and smooth operations of the business.
Key
Duties & Responsibilities:
* Prepare comprehensive client review packs for upcoming meetings.
* Maintain accurate and up-to-date client records in line with internal processes.
* Liaise with third parties and internal departments to obtain information and answer client queries.
* Prioritise work effectively between emails, tasks, post, reviews and phone calls.
* Support, train, and mentor new team members to ensure smooth onboarding and development.
* Keep Financial Planners informed of progress and raise any concerns as needed.
* Assist with front-of-house duties during reception cover (breaks, sickness, annual leave).
* Contribute to the ongoing improvement of systems and processes by providing feedback.
* Ensure compliance by maintaining a clear audit trail and using systems accurately.
Essential Skills & Attributes:
* Proven administrative or secretarial experience, ideally within financial services.
* Strong organisational skills with excellent attention to detail.
* Confident communicator - written and verbal.
* Proficient IT and data management skills.
* Ability to follow procedures and manage time effectively.
* Professional, trustworthy, and curious with a willingness to learn.
* GCSEs/A-Levels in English and Maths (or equivalent)
In return, you will receive:
* 38 Days Annual Leave - incl. Christmas closure, your birthday off & bank holidays
* Fully Funded Training & Exams + Paid Study Leave
* Flexible Working & Free Parking
* 5% Employer Pension Contribution
* Profit Share Bonus & Length of Service Recognition
* Healthcare Benefits - Life Cover, Income Protection, Cash Plan & Subsidised Private Healthcare
* Wellbeing Perks - Free Drinks, Fruit, Cycle to Work Scheme & Employee Assistance
* Regular Social Events & 15% Discount on Legal Services
